What You’ll Need

Gather these simple ingredients to create the Ultimate Steak Marinade:

  • 1/2 cup soy sauce
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ce
  • 2 tablespoons Dijon mustard
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on brown sugar
  • 1 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der

Let’s Make It Together

Now that we have our ingredients ready, let’s dive into creating this savory marinade!

  1. In a bowl, whisk together the soy sauce, olive oil, Worcestershire sauce, Dijon mustard, garlic, brown sugar, black pepper, and onion powder until well combined.
  2. Place the steak in a resealable plastic bag or shallow dish and pour the marinade over the steak, ensuring it’s well coated.
  3. Seal the bag or cover the dish and marinate in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es, or overnight for best results.
  4. Remove the steak from the marinade and discard the marinade—this part is key; we only want the flavor that’s soaked into the steak!
  5. Grill or pan-sear the steak to your desired doneness. Enjoy your savory steak!

Delicious Variations to Try

Looking to add a personal touch? Here are a few creative ideas to customize your Ultimate Steak Marinade:

  • Zesty Citrus: Add the juice of one lemon or lime for a bright, refreshing twist that enhances the flavors of the marinade.
  • Herbed Delight: Mix in fresh herbs like rosemary or thyme for an aromatic finish that feels rustic and homey.
  • Spicy Kick: Incorporate a dash of cayenne pepper or red pepper flakes for those who enjoy a hint of heat.
  • Sweet and Smoky: Add a tablespoon of smoked paprika for a rich, smoky flavor that pairs beautifully with grilled steak.

Chef Emma’s Helpful Tips

To ensure you achieve the best results, consider these kitchen secrets:

  • Make-Ahead: This marinade can be prepared up to a week in advance. Just store it in an airtight container in the refrigerator, ready for your busy nights!
  • Ingredient Swaps: You can substitute tamari for soy sauce if you’re looking for a gluten-free option without sacrificing flavor.
  • Slicing Techniques: For the most delicious bites, slice the cooked steak against the grain. This ensures each piece remains tender and easy to chew.
  • Leftover Storage: Keep any leftover steak tightly wrapped in the fridge for up to three days. It makes a fantastic addition to salads or sandwiches!
